#ffdb69 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ffdb69 is composed of 100% red, 85.9%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 14.1% magenta, 58.8%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 45.6 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 70.6%. #ffdb69 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d2 with #ffb700.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

Shades and Tints of #ffdb69

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070500 is the darkest color, while #fffcf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ffdb69

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bab7ae is the less saturated color, while #ffdb69 is the most saturated one.
